PATENT REFERENCE 02
U.S. Patent #10,328,152
The patented sub-nano absorption technology, Auro GSH™, used in the topical glutathione spray Glutaryl® by Dr. Nayan Patel and Auro Wellness, is identified as U.S. Patent No. 10,328,152 for stabilization and transdermal delivery.
U.S. PATENT NUMBER
The VARS® Glutathione oral patent is identified in the provided reference as U.S. Patent #10,272,130, covering encapsulated reduced glutathione liposome delivery.

What does VARS mean?
VARS means Validated, Absorbable, Reduced, and Stable: validated by acceptable research and patent standards; readily absorbable either orally or topically; reduced, not oxidized like many market forms that are already used up or dead and will not work as needed; and shelf stable for at least one year, if not two.
